If you're taking a GLP1 agonist (ex ozempic) and have an elective surgery coming up you MUST tell your anesthesiologist and stop the meds 2+ weeks beforehand. Many anesthesiologists report increased cases of aspiration (patient vomits, gunk goes to lungs) because patients are withholding this info. It doesn't matter if you got it off the black/gray market. It doesn't matter if you're taking a "microdose" - tell your doctor. This is one of those ... Could save your life kinda things.

Polycystic kidney disease (PKD, PCKD) is a genetic disorder that results in many cysts growing within the kidneys. They may form before birth, during childhood, or in adulthood. When cysts develop before birth growth failure or breathing problems may occur. Otherwise symptoms may include flank pain, blood in the urine, and headaches. Complications may include kidney failure, high blood pressure, liver cysts, aortic aneurysm, and cerebral aneurysm. It occurs as a result of a genetic mutation. Generally this is inherited from a persons parents though may rarely occur spontaneously during early development. The cysts form from non-functioning tubules that have fluid pumped into them. There are two types autosomal dominant polycystic kidney disease (ADPKD) and autosomal recessive polycystic kidney disease (ARPKD). The diagnosis maybe confirmed by medical imaging or genetic testing. There is no cure. Treatment may include lifestyle changes and medications to reduce blood pressure such as ACE inhibitors. Kidney failure may be managed with dialysis or kidney transplant. About 30% of those with ARPKD die within the first few weeks of life. More than half of people with ADPKD develop kidney failure by the age of 70. PKD affects about half a million people in the United States. ADPKD affects about 1 in 700 people and ARPKD affects about 1 in 20,000 children. Males and females are affected equally frequently The condition was first described in the 16th and 17th centuries. #MEDHM

No need to make a thread, I think this one comes down to culture: in China people just don't drink cold water. An anecdote on this. When my elder daughter was still a toddler in her stroller, we were waiting for our plane in an airport lobby in Shanghai and she was thirsty so I gave her cold mineral water to drink. People around us were absolutely appalled, some older ladies even physically took the bottle away from her and started berating me as if I'd given my daughter poison! And to them it is: according to Traditional Chinese Medicine concepts cold water is extremely disruptive to the Stomach and Spleen's homeostasis and can cause strong digestion issues. So I think that's probably the main explanation: what would be the point of making huge investments to deliver cold potable water to people's tap if no-one is going to drink it? The water just needs to be good enough so that it is potable after boiling, which it is. To test this theory observe Chinese tourists in countries that do have potable tap water and you will see 100% that, despite this, still none of them are drinking it.
